Palestinians threaten to cancel election in vote row
The Palestinian Authority will cancel parliamentary elections planed for January 25 if Israel goes ahead with its plan to bar Jerusalem Palestinians from voting.
“If the Israelis insist on not allowing us to conduct the elections in Jerusalem, then there will be no elections at all,” said Information Minister Nabil Shaath.
Israeli officials today said that Israel would not allow Jerusalem Palestinians to vote because it objected to the participation of Hamas militants in the race, and did not want to help bring its candidates to power.
